The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act and
the Health Care and Education Reconciliation Act
will re-shape the business and delivery of health
care for this decade and well beyond. At this
juncture, it is not enough to simply study the
detailed provisions of the Acts. Organizations must
carefully consider the implications and strategic
viewpoint for positioning themselves going forward.
Join two nationally prominent experts: Paul Keckley,
PhD, Executive Director of the Deloitte Center for
Health Solutions, and Doug Hastings, Chair of the
Board of Directors, Epstein Becker & Green, as they
guide you through the strategic perspectives and
applicable implications of the Acts, with particular
emphasis on purchasers and providers, and payment
and delivery system reform. |
